But that would definitely be a post 1.5.4 > item. Yeah, we eventually need to redo "git mergetool" in C. One of the reasons for that is at the moment it can't take advantage of the rename detection machinery, so in the case where there is a merge conflict involving a file that has been renamed in one of the two branches, "git mergetool" doesn't do the right thing. Even if it would be possible to expose the rename machinery in a form that would be convenient for a shell script, it's past time to rewrite it in C, I think.... - Ted
